## Ticket: Config drift on FuelLedger report workers

Priority: High

While validating the quarterly fleet fuel-usage report, I found that the three report workers in the Brackenford cluster are no longer consistent with the baseline manifest. Worker two has a stale aggregation window and a different rounding mode, which explains the 0.4% variance flagged by finance. I have confirmed the drift is limited to these hosts and is not present in staging. For your review, the expected baseline configuration is reproduced below.

config for kafof-bawef:
holath:
  log_level: debug
  metrics_host: metrics.holath.qorvelsys.internal
  pin: 2191
  pool_size: 32

Runbook: Ferngate incremental rebuilds. When a content editor publishes, the Mosswick builder rebuilds only pages whose source hash changed; a full rebuild runs nightly. If pages look stale, check the hash cache before forcing a full build — full builds take forty minutes. Contractors: never clear the cache on prod without pinging the on-call. The builder pulls content from the Thistledown CMS over an authenticated channel, and the line immediately after this one in the env file sets that credential.

secret setting of yafof-tawep: RELAY_SECRET8=8abb5772

**Runbook: Regaining access to the Lintbox publishing account**

Quick reminder for the sync: Lintbox (our shared component library) versions are published from the `canister` bot account, and that account locks itself after three failed token refreshes. When that happens, nobody can cut a patch release — so don't panic, recover. Hit the registry's recovery page, pick the bot account, and skip the email option since the inbox is dead. Enter the passphrase below:

vault phrase of faduf-bajep = tamius-rusox-holok-kasdor-rusdor-druius-giliel-ulaox-zoriel

Handover — Dovel Works, east lobby. Marta: the turnstile upgrade at Brinmore House continues through Thursday. Visiting contractors should use the side gate by the loading dock until the new readers are live. Vendor crew from Kestrel Gateworks arrives at 08:00. For contractor entry during the works, use the temporary pass below.

badge for bawif-yawig: bdg-XQF-7